Pay range for this position is $34.25 - $51.13/hour.
Actual pay is based on years of licensure.
This is an Hourly position.
The Nurse Navigator serves as a patient advocate, educator, and coordinator, guiding patients and families through the healthcare continuum during the pre and post surgical areas. This role ensures patients receive timely, seamless, and compassionate care while supporting clinical teams in reducing barriers, improving outcomes, and enhancing the patient experience. The Nurse Navigator models the Mission, Values, and service standards through every interaction.
Education: BSN (Bachelors of Nursing) Experience: 3 years’ experience in areas such as Cardiology, Neuro Surgery, special procedures etc. Working knowledge of perioperative patient care processes. OSF HealthCare is an Equal Opportunity Employer.
Requires an Associate degree in nursing and at least 3 years of experience in medical/surgical or ambulatory surgery settings. Must hold a current Illinois RN license and BLS CPR certification.
